Wayanad was formed as the 12th district of Kerala carved out of Kozhikode and Kannur districts. The word Wayanad means the Land of Paddy Fields. Known for the numerous indigenous tribal’s in this area, Wayanad is set on the majestic Western Ghats with altitudes ranging from 700 to 2100 m.

Wayanad has an extensive forest cover, valleys, varied flora and fauna, waterfalls, lakes and historic monuments that makes it a tourist hot spot and one of the most visited districts in Kerala.

Wayanad lies on the border of the neighbouring states of Tamil Nadu and Karnataka; the strategic location has also been a boon for the tourism development in Wayanad. Other tourist spots like Ooty, Mysore, Coorg and Bangalore are close to Wayanad.

Chembra Peak is the highest peak in Wayanad at a height ...
... of about 2100 metres and considered to be a trekkers' paradise. There is a lake at the summit which promises spectacular views from the top.

Pakshipaathalam and the Brahmagiri Hills are also favoured trekking destinations. The 6 km trek from Tirunelli takes you through thick jungle. A lot of resorts and hotels can organise the guided treks and can arrange for camp sites and other activities at these destinations.

If history intrigues you, then you have come to the right place. Wayanad packages to Sultan Bathery, a small town in Wayanad that derives its name from the Nizam of Hyderabad, Tipu Sultan will interest you if you are an ardent history student. Tipu built a fort that was known as Sultan's Battery, as he used this place to store ammunition.
Pazhassi Raja, considered the 'Lion of Kerala', was the first to fight a guerrilla war against the British. In the memory of Pazhassi Raja a tomb has been built near Mananthavady in Wayanad.

Believed to be in existence from the New Stone Age, Wayanad is full of archaeological sites as well. Edakkal caves, an ancient rock shelter, 4000 feet up the mountain, are famous for the rock art depicting human and animal carvings.

For the religious, Wayanad packages to the Ananthanatha Swamy Temple, popularly referred to as the Jain Temple, the Tirunelli Temple, Papanasini, Valliyoorkavu Temple, Sita Lava Kusha Temple, Thrissilery Shiva Temple and the Pallikkunnu Church is a must for the religiously fervent.

The nearest airport is Karipur international airport in Kozhikode and the nearest railway station to Wayanad is the Kozhikode railway station.
